This book contains a revolutionary new system for Past-Life Regression and Imagery Therapy called The IRE Approach(TM). Learn inductions, deepening techniques, how to facilitate past-life regression therapy sessions and imagery sessions and other crucial hypnotherapy techniques. This book is a MUST HAVE for therapists I.R.E. stands for "Imaginative Role-Enactment". This is a complete hypnotherapy system created by Certified Master Hypnotist Christopher S. Harris. "Most Past-Life Regression Therapists are approaching the technique as true to life - They will tell you that they are actually taking you back to a time that you have lived before. But The IRE Approach(TM) does not assume that you believe in Past-Lives and we do not propose that that is what we are doing. The IRE Approach(TM) treats Past-Life Regression as Imaginative Role-Enactment and so the topic of "reincarnation" and the risk of conflicting with the client's belief system is never an issue. This approach is a Godsend to hypnotherapists specializing in Past-Life Regression therapy because now by framing the procedure in a different way it is accessible for use with every client. You are no longer forced to use a modality that you think is less-effective for the client's particular issue just because your chosen technique is controversial.
